Problems solved by technology

[0004] At present, the proposal issued by TMF (TeleManagement Forum, Telecommunications Management Forum) establishes the management of the protection group on a single network element, but this protection group is still established on the basis of a single network element. Other protection groups in the same protection subnet are not related to each other. When the high-level network management manages, it can only obtain the information of this individual protection group, but cannot know the information of other protection groups that work together with this protection group.
When there is a problem with a certain protected service, when the protection group initiates a protection service request to other network elements, it is possible that other network elements have not established a service protection group, or the information of the established protection group does not correspond. The created protection group cannot guarantee that the service is truly protected; the high-level network management cannot obtain complete information of the entire network, nor can it effectively manage the entire network
[0005] To sum up, although the existing technology can also manage the network, the high-level network management cannot completely obtain the information of the entire protection network, and the business cannot be truly and effectively protected. Therefore, the high-level network management cannot effectively and comprehensively manage the entire network. management

[0042] The present invention provides a method for obtaining network information. The method defines a series of high-level network management and lower-level network management for network-level network management NMS (Network Management System) and operation support system OSS (Operation Support System) through CORBA IDL language. Interface, and the NMS and OSS use protection subnets to obtain more network information and manage the network more comprehensively.

Abstract

This invention provides one method to acquire network information, which comprises the following steps: first network sends preset protector sub network information index orders; second management receives the said order and requires protection sub network relative information and sends required information to first network management. The invention provides one network management system composed of first and second managements. Through above method and system, it is helpful to get whole network information and whole management.

technical field [0001] The invention relates to the field of optical technology communication, in particular to a method for acquiring network information and a network management system. Background technique [0002] Optical fiber communication systems are widely used due to their huge bandwidth and resources and relatively low manufacturing costs. At present, the optical fiber transmission network has become the leading transmission network in all countries in the world. However, the high-level network management of the existing optical transport network generally only manages the network elements in the protection field, and does not involve the management of the network layer.
